Course Overview

The Bachelor of Science in Chemistry at Moravian University equips you with a robust understanding of chemical principles and their vital applications in addressing contemporary global challenges. You will explore the intricate world of chemical reactions, molecular structures, and analytical techniques, preparing you for advanced study or a dynamic career. This undergraduate degree is ideal for inquisitive students passionate about scientific inquiry and eager to contribute to fields like environmental science, medicine, or materials science. You will delve into core areas such as organic chemistry, physical chemistry, and biochemistry, fostering a comprehensive scientific skillset.

This full-time, on-campus program, typically completed over four years, offers a hands-on learning experience. You will engage with modern chemical instrumentation, gaining practical expertise in analytical techniques like spectroscopy and chromatography. The curriculum encourages direct collaboration with faculty on research projects, allowing you to explore specialisations in theoretical, analytical, or biochemistry. You will graduate with a comprehensive understanding of chemistry, prepared for roles in research and development, quality control, or further graduate studies, with the option of an ACS-certified B.S. in chemistry.

Cost & Affordability

A clear picture of what this course will cost you

Program Costs

First Year Fee Tuition fee
USD 51,568.00
Second Year Fee Tuition fee
USD 51,568.00
Third Year Fee Tuition fee
USD 51,568.00
Fourth Year Fee Tuition fee
USD 51,568.00
Total Program Cost Estimated total tuition
USD 206,272.00

Currency note: Program costs shown in USD based on the available tuition breakdown.
